namespace casacore { //# NAMESPACE CASACORE - BEGIN
// <summary>
// View multiple FITS files as a single table
// </summary>
// <use visibility=local>
// <reviewed reviewer="" date="yyyy/mm/dd" tests="" demos="">
// </reviewed>
// <synopsis>
// A FITSMultiTable is used to view a collection of FITS files on disk as a
// single Table. That is, when next() is called, when one Table ends the next
// is reopened until all files are exhausted. The FITS files must all have the
// same description. Something clever should be done about the keywords.
// </synopsis>

class FITSMultiTable : public FITSTabular
{
public:
// The FITS files associated with the fileNames must all have the same
// description, the second argument is a function to generate the
// FITSTabular If not specified, a generic FITSTable is assumed.
// The returned pointer IS controlled by this object.
FITSMultiTable(const Vector<String> &fileNames,
FITSTabular* (*tabMaker)(const String &) = 0);
~FITSMultiTable();
virtual Bool isValid() const;
virtual const TableRecord &keywords() const;
virtual const RecordDesc &description() const;
virtual const Record &units() const;
virtual const Record &displayFormats() const;
virtual const Record &nulls() const;
virtual const String &name() const { return table_p->name(); }
// Only returns True when all files are exhausted.
virtual Bool pastEnd() const;
// When end of data is hit on the current file, the next file is opened
// automatically.
virtual void next();
virtual const Record ¤tRow() const;
// get the list of file names
const Vector<String>& fileNames() const { return file_names_p;}
// Has the descriptor changed from when the file was opened
virtual Bool hasChanged() const { return hasChanged_p;}
// set hasChanged to False - used after hasChanged has been checked
void resetChangedFlag() { hasChanged_p = False;}
// A helper function to generate a list of fileNames. This function returns
// all the files in "directoryName" which have the form
// yyyy_mm_dd_hh:mm:ss_*.fits and which are (even partially)
// in the time range specified by startTime and endTime. It is used to
// generate a set of file names for use in the FITSMultiTable constructor.
// If verboseStatus is True, some status messages appear on cout.
// If verboseErrors is True improperly named files names (not matching the above
// pattern) are named on cerrt.
static Vector<String> filesInTimeRange(const String &directoryName,
const Time &startTime, const Time &endTime,
Bool verboseErrors = False,
Bool verboseStatus = False);
// return the time as found in the given string using the form given above
// There are no sanity checks in this subroutine
static Time timeFromFile(const String &fileName);
private:
// Undefined and inaccessible
FITSMultiTable();
FITSMultiTable(const FITSMultiTable &other);
FITSMultiTable &operator=(const FITSMultiTable &other);
FITSTabular *table_p;
Vector<String> file_names_p;
uInt nfiles_p;
uInt which_file_p;
Bool hasChanged_p;
Record row_p;
FITSTabular* defaultMaker(const String& fileName);
};
} //# NAMESPACE CASACORE - END
